Description: Uxbridge-MA photographer Mike Zeis is displaying photographs of faded wall advertisements. During the first half of the 20th century, when our downtowns were bustling, painting your message on the side of a building was a principal method of advertising. Many surviving wall ads have lost their color to sun, snow, and rain, but remain beautiful in their faded state. Other signs, like the Coca-Cola sign on Elm Street in Southbridge Mass, were protected over the years by adjacent buildings. The neighboring building was demolished last year, so now the Southbridge sign can be seen by the public for first time in decades, with its original colors pretty much intact.

The "Delicious and Refreshing" exhibit includes more than 25 photographs of painted wall ads, shot in New England and beyond. Ads for Coca-Cola, Diamond Ginger Ale, Wrigley's chewing gum, Quaker Oats, and other brands are included in the exhibit.

Most of Zeis' photos were taken with vintage film cameras, some modified to add distortion. A lifelong photographer, Zeis has been documenting the American roadside since 2004.
